feat(runtime): bridge executor completion to the placement stream
Cutover slice C0 (docs/plans/2026-08-02-placement-cutover.md): the seam work that lets C3 flip hosts onto a complete receipt stream instead of growing one mid-cutover. The executor's Released exit now publishes an acknowledge-only ExecutorCompleted receipt through the one placement projection stream — registered before observer dispatch, correlated to the full execution receipt, reaped exactly once on acknowledgement/ discard/session-clear, and counted in the convergence ledger. All three production placement sinks acknowledge-and-ignore the new kind via early returns proven behavior-preserving for every existing kind; without them the first such receipt at cutover would permanently wedge the exact-head FIFO behind sinks that return false. Provably inert today: the publisher has no production caller. Execute's live inputs now derive from Runtime's own owners bound at GameRuntime construction: UsePositionFromServer is retail's exact autonomy_level != 2 (CommandInterpreter::UsePositionFromServer 0x006B3B40, startup-only knob), and PlayerDistance uses the live movement controller's position with a null-safe fallback to the caller struct — never a fabricated origin. TryPrepareAndSubmitAuthoredPlacement chains the prepared-collision Setup read through PrepareMover to submission with zero validation-semantics changes. TryCommitParent and CommitWithdrawal gain the sibling cancellation flow (residence + ordinary placement family); TryCommitParent deliberately omits LeaveWorld — retail's set_parent performs its single gated leave_world (0x00515A90) and a second would have no counterpart. Not fully dormant: the two cancellation fixes change Runtime paths production already calls (today as no-op-adjacent hardening, since nothing upstream begins a residence yet); everything else is reachable only by tests. Reviewed: retail-conformance PASS + architecture/ adversarial PASS after one fix round (sink wedge, completion-receipt lifecycle, null-controller distance).
